Security Surveillance System

By: Dylan Home | Home-and-Family | Home-Improvement


Security surveillance systems usually involve the use of closed circuit video cameras. Used by private individuals and large corporations, these systems are used to monitor and record the broadcast from the video cameras. These systems are becoming increasingly popular for businesses and private individuals to help the law enforcement and security companies prevent crime and maintain peace in certain areas or for businesses.

Security surveillance systems with CCTV have increased in use over the past ten years, and have become a popular and useful method to monitor cities, private buildings and homes. Many towns and cities around the world now use closed circuit video cameras to maintain peace and prevent crime in their areas. Security companies and town officials can use these closed circuit video cameras to deter crime within the towns, along with helping to apprehend criminals.

Security surveillance systems with CCTV were initially built for security within banks whereas today it has become an inexpensive and successful security system for businesses, shops and even within the home. Business owners and entrepreneurs are using these closed circuit video cameras to monitor staff behavior within work time. Security surveillance systems with CCTV are a useful method to protect your assets and help recover stolen items. The advance within the security surveillance system technology has led to CCTV surveillance systems becoming one of the most valuable and successful tools in the fight against loss prevention, management and even safety and security. Many retail shops use CCTV to monitor and prevent shoplifters and dishonest employees.

A great benefit of security surveillance systems is that the business, home or city can be monitored from many miles away, this will mean that business owners, home owners and city police and security officials can enjoy the peace of mind option of 24 hour monitoring. Large corporations, businesses and hospitals also use these monitoring systems to identify and observe visitors in the work area and monitor the security in parking areas.

The ultimate choice design for security surveillance systems is where your home or business is protected by CCTV for the entire perimeter.
